A tourist in China was labelled a "poor ghost" by a shop owner after she entered a shop, asked for the price of a jewellery item but did not buy anything from the store, a South China Morning Post report said.

The incident took place on February 25 in the city of Xiamen situated in the southeastern Chinese province of Fujian where a woman traveller, accompanied by her partner, had paid a visit to a pearl shop and asked the cost of a jewellery item and later turned to leave.

The woman's behavior left the shop owner unamused and the man called her a "poor ghost" for leaving by merely asking the prices and not buying anything from the shop.

"Poor ghost can't afford it, but still asked the price," the owner said.
